Sessanta Racconti by Dino Buzzati
This collection of sixty short stories delves into the surreal and the fantastical, blending elements of magical realism with existential themes. Each tale explores the human condition through a variety of lenses, often highlighting the absurdity and unpredictability of life. The stories range from whimsical to dark, offering profound insights into fear, hope, and the complexities of human nature. The author's unique narrative style and imaginative scenarios invite readers to reflect on the deeper meanings hidden within everyday experiences.
